Riga FC vs RFS Preview: Virsliga Clash Today
Riga FC and RFS meet in a Virsliga encounter with both sides arriving in strong form. Riga FC has won three of their last five matches, while RFS have claimed four wins from five outings. The sides know each other well, with their last ten meetings producing an even split: three wins apiece and four draws. Today's 16:00 kick-off offers little to separate two evenly matched competitors in Latvia's top division.

Head-to-Head Record and Historical Context
The historical record between these sides is remarkably balanced. Across their last ten meetings, Riga FC have won three, RFS have won three, and four matches have ended in draws. This 3-3-4 split indicates neither side holds a psychological or tactical advantage over the other, and suggests matches between them tend to be competitive and closely contested. Such equilibrium often produces tight scorelines and matches decided by fine margins.
